You can capture en passant when your opponent pushes his pawn twice (to the 4th rank (white) or the 5th rank (black)) and you have a pawn sitting next to it. Then you can capture the pawn as if it only moved one square - but only immediately after the pawn push of your opponent, you can't delay this.About Press Copyright Contact us Creators Advertise Developers Terms Privacy Policy & Safety How YouTube works Test new features NFL Sunday Ticket Press Copyright ...Mar 31, 2020 · En passant involves pawns capturing pawns. No other pieces can capture or be captured. The capturing pawn must be three squares from his starting line. So a white pawn must stand on the 5th rank to make the capture and a black pawn must stand on the 4th rank. The pawn-to-be-captured must jump two squares from its starting position, ending up ... EN PASSANT CAPTURES: As early as 1200 A.D., pawns have been able to move forward two squares forward on their initial move. The point of contention was if a …Is en passant a forced move? No, the en passant capture in chess is not a forced move. It is an optional move that the player has the choice to make or not. While it can be a strategic move to take advantage of the opportunity and gain an advantage in the game, the player is not obligated to make the en passant capture. What is En passant? It is not checkmate if the other player has any legal move that gets them out of check. Capturing the checking piece is one such way; whether the capture is en passant or not is irrelevant for the purpose of this question. In this case, an en passant capture is the only legal move. You might have just enough t...en passant does mean "in passing", but the English phrase is not generally used in our specialized chess sense; e.g. Merriam-Webster separates two senses of en passant:. 1) in passing, 2) used in chess of the capture of a pawn as it makes a first move of two squares by an enemy pawn that threatens the first of these squares.The en passant move in chess has been around for quite some time. Sources state that the move was first invented in the year 1561 but didn’t get officially accepted in the FIDE rule book until the year 1880. Before 1880, some European countries such as Italy did not adopt the en passant rule. This exclusion was known as passar battaglia.HowStuffWorks talked to experts in disaster relief to find out the best ways to help people in times of disaster. Advertisement We humans have big hearts.
